Related: Editorials & Other Articles, Issue Forums, Alliance Forums, Region ForumsGiffords Able To Move Right Arm Again, Three Years After Shooting
http://talkingpointsmemo.com/livewire/gabby_giffords_gun_control_persistencehttp://a4.img.talkingpointsmemo.com/image/upload/c_fill,fl_keep_iptc,g_faces,h_365,w_652/fourth-of-july-giffords-cincinnati.jpg
"Our fight is a lot more like my rehab," she continued. "Every day, we must wake up resolved and determined."
Giffords also revealed in the op-ed that after rigorous physical therapy she was able to regain some movement in her right arm, which was left paralyzed after the shooting. She wants that recovery to serve as a lesson for a gridlocked Congress.
"We will fight for every inch, because that means saving lives," she wrote. "Ive seen grit overcome paralysis. My resolution today is that Congress achieve the same."
